What is Cheetah?
Cheetah operates as a pioneering restaurant supply application, dedicated to providing the most straightforward and cost-effective solution for restaurants to procure their daily operational necessities. Since commencing operations in 2015, the company has rapidly evolved into an indispensable service for thousands of eateries, supplying them with a comprehensive range of products essential for business continuity. The company's focus on simplifying procurement and optimizing costs positions it as a critical partner in the competitive food service industry.
How much funding has Cheetah raised?
Cheetah has raised a total of $141.9M across 5 funding rounds:

Series A (2018): $29.9M with participation from ICONIQ Capital, AltaIR Capital, Floodgate, and Hanaco Venture Capital
Debt (2020): $2M led by PPP
Series B (2020): $36M supported by Eclipse Ventures, Floodgate Fund, Hanaco, and ICONIQ Capital
Series C (2022): $60M featuring Manna Tree Partners
Other Financing Round (2024): $14M, investors not publicly disclosed
Key Investors in Cheetah
Manna Tree Partners
Manna Tree Partners is an investment company focused on improving human health and wellness through strategic investments, aiming to empower consumers and deliver strong financial returns. They invest in sectors experiencing shifts in consumer preferences related to health and wellness.
Eclipse Ventures
Eclipse Ventures is a venture capital firm that excels in developing partnerships to achieve aesthetically attractive quality projects, taking pride in accomplishing goals where others have failed.
Floodgate Fund
Floodgate Fund is a venture capital firm specializing in early-stage investments in technology companies, aiming to support extraordinary founders at the pre-seed and seed stages with a focus on pattern breakers.
